Output 5cb76ecde81a808665c5c0f92f0a57e6cf541c0851200ed02e6268fef75f1c86:3

value
140073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5928de5d09768108695dd91cd71338cb8a20f86 OP_EQUAL
address
3Q5V3K61Embr9hFtwAAUNmK4PRVWqLzoYC
transaction
5cb76ecde81a808665c5c0f92f0a57e6cf541c0851200ed02e6268fef75f1c86
spent
true